Transaction e12d6c81b1e9704ab9c58c7a5f3c92ccde3d0cd56940905c0ddc1797f0888e89

224 Input
2 Outputs
  • e12d6c81b1e9704ab9c58c7a5f3c92ccde3d0cd56940905c0ddc1797f0888e89:0
  • value  7500000000
    address  3LSTvStL8xM8P7h56Mz6cLpcRARmS7hVhm
  • e12d6c81b1e9704ab9c58c7a5f3c92ccde3d0cd56940905c0ddc1797f0888e89:1
  • value  29248109
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v